Controversy over Unauthorized Parody of Ika Musume in Index II Blu-ray Special

According to the official website, PonyCanyon is perplexed by a parody of Shinryaku! Ika Musume in the extra short anime of Toaru Majutsu no Index II included in the first volume of the Blu-ray and DVD. Geneon, the producer of Index, hasn't obtained a permission from PonyCanyon, the producer of Ika Musume. In the short anime, Index speaks with "Geso" desinence and extends tentacles.

Screenshot of Index-tan II

PonyCanyon said they take the parody as a fan-service out of good intentions, but insisted that some of the Ika Musume staff were hurt by the unauthorized parody.

Update
PonyCanyon producer Ishiguro Tatsuya removed the post about the parody from the official blog and apologized for provoking unwanted antagonism between the fans of the two anime. He said the investigation of the issue will be conducted between the two sides, not in public.

Source: Ikamusume official website
